A Fantasy is a great plane, that is more than capable of some fairly aggressive 3D. However, exactly what makes it good at 3D makes it not so great for pattern. It's a compromise. It will do both, and fly pattern competetively. But if you are going to compete, I'd check out the Symphony from Aeroslave. It may not do really aggressive 3D, but it will do a lot of stuff. And it's excellent at pattern. Plus it's made here in the USA so you don't have to worry about support, and it doesn't cost that much compared to other full tilt pattern planes.

Personally I like to keep my 3d and pattern in different packages. That way you have planes that excel at both, just not the same exact airframe.
